diff --git a/tile.c b/tile.c
new file mode 100644 (file)
index 0000000..a9bc0f5
--- /dev/null
+++ b/tile.c
@@ -0,0 +1,132 @@
+/* (C)opyright MMVI-MMVII Anselm R. Garbe <garbeam at gmail dot com>
+ * See LICENSE file for license details.
+ */
+#include "dwm.h"
+
+/* static */
+
+static void
+togglemax(Client *c) {
+       XEvent ev;
+               
+       if(c->isfixed)
+               return;
+
+       if((c->ismax = !c->ismax)) {
+               c->rx = c->x;
+               c->ry = c->y;
+               c->rw = c->w;
+               c->rh = c->h;
+               resize(c, wax, way, waw - 2 * BORDERPX, wah - 2 * BORDERPX, True);
+       }
+       else
+               resize(c, c->rx, c->ry, c->rw, c->rh, True);
+       while(XCheckMaskEvent(dpy, EnterWindowMask, &ev));
+}
+
+/* extern */
+
+void
+dotile(void) {
+       unsigned int i, n, nx, ny, nw, nh, mw, mh, tw, th;
+       Client *c;
+
+       for(n = 0, c = nextmanaged(clients); c; c = nextmanaged(c->next))
+               n++;
+       /* window geoms */
+       mh = (n > nmaster) ? wah / nmaster : wah / (n > 0 ? n : 1);
+       mw = (n > nmaster) ? (waw * master) / 1000 : waw;
+       th = (n > nmaster) ? wah / (n - nmaster) : 0;
+       tw = waw - mw;
+
+       for(i = 0, c = clients; c; c = c->next)
+               if(isvisible(c)) {
+                       if(c->isbanned)
+                               XMoveWindow(dpy, c->win, c->x, c->y);
+                       c->isbanned = False;
+                       if(c->isfloat)
+                               continue;
+                       c->ismax = False;
+                       nx = wax;
+                       ny = way;
+                       if(i < nmaster) {
+                               ny += i * mh;
+                               nw = mw - 2 * BORDERPX;
+                               nh = mh - 2 * BORDERPX;
+                       }
+                       else {  /* tile window */
+                               nx += mw;
+                               nw = tw - 2 * BORDERPX;
+                               if(th > 2 * BORDERPX) {
+                                       ny += (i - nmaster) * th;
+                                       nh = th - 2 * BORDERPX;
+                               }
+                               else /* fallback if th <= 2 * BORDERPX */
+                                       nh = wah - 2 * BORDERPX;
+                       }
+                       resize(c, nx, ny, nw, nh, False);
+                       i++;
+               }
+               else {
+                       c->isbanned = True;
+                       XMoveWindow(dpy, c->win, c->x + 2 * sw, c->y);
+               }
+       if(!sel || !isvisible(sel)) {
+               for(c = stack; c && !isvisible(c); c = c->snext);
+               focus(c);
+       }
+       restack();
+}
+
+void
+incnmaster(Arg *arg) {
+       if((arrange == dofloat) || (nmaster + arg->i < 1)
+       || (wah / (nmaster + arg->i) <= 2 * BORDERPX))
+               return;
+       nmaster += arg->i;
+       if(sel)
+               arrange();
+       else
+               drawstatus();
+}
+
+void
+resizemaster(Arg *arg) {
+       if(arrange != dotile)
+               return;
+       if(arg->i == 0)
+               master = MASTER;
+       else {
+               if(waw * (master + arg->i) / 1000 >= waw - 2 * BORDERPX
+               || waw * (master + arg->i) / 1000 <= 2 * BORDERPX)
+                       return;
+               master += arg->i;
+       }
+       arrange();
+}
+
+void
+zoom(Arg *arg) {
+       unsigned int n;
+       Client *c;
+
+       if(!sel)
+               return;
+       if(sel->isfloat || (arrange == dofloat)) {
+               togglemax(sel);
+               return;
+       }
+       for(n = 0, c = nextmanaged(clients); c; c = nextmanaged(c->next))
+               n++;
+
+       if((c = sel) == nextmanaged(clients))
+               if(!(c = nextmanaged(c->next)))
+                       return;
+       detach(c);
+       if(clients)
+               clients->prev = c;
+       c->next = clients;
+       clients = c;
+       focus(c);
+       arrange();
+}
